The business: Recycling Lives Services is not a typical recycling company. Since 2008, the business has been structurally built around social value, employing people from disadvantaged backgrounds, partnering with the justice system to reduce reoffending, and delivering environmental excellence at scale. The social mission is not a layer added on top of commercial activity. It is the reason the business operates in the way it does.
As a certified B Corp (scoring 103.5 against a business median of 50.9), Recycling Lives Services generated £42.9m in social value in 2024, achieved a 61% reduction in CO2 emissions, and diverted 97% of waste from landfill. 15% of our team have been welcomed through our rehabilitation programmes, and only 6% of people we support reoffend — compared to a national average of over 25%. We operate UK-wide across construction, manufacturing, retail, utilities and public sector markets, offering total waste management, WEEE recycling, and specialist hazardous waste services.
